Output 31a471a65e453ded440353c22ef9a792e5cfa1a7d36e7b0a87374260c372614f:3

value
6594000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291041920efcd1cf3a597f3b775428c0a654b1db OP_EQUAL
address
35S96uSC8uwWnjHxxEvxFjgAV7Dx8Vkppa
transaction
31a471a65e453ded440353c22ef9a792e5cfa1a7d36e7b0a87374260c372614f
spent
true